On the 11th local time, Ukrainian President Zelensky met with visiting German Defense Minister Pistorius in Kyiv. The two sides held consultations focused on issues including joint weapons production and drone cooperation, and reached consensus. Zelensky said that Germany’s cumulative military assistance to Ukraine has reached 28.6 billion euros, and that the two countries are currently advancing six joint weapons production projects. This initiative marks an important start in military technology cooperation between the two sides. During the meeting, the two sides finalized a 10-year drone cooperation agreement. Zelensky expressed his thanks to Germany for the Ukraine air defense systems support agreement signed last month, but has not yet disclosed the specific details of the agreement. Zelensky also spoke highly of the assistance Germany has provided to Ukraine in the energy sector, and revealed that Pistorius had visited an energy facility in Ukraine in person before the meeting. In addition, on the same day, the defense ministers of Ukraine and Germany signed a memorandum of cooperation, officially launching the “Brave Germany” joint program to help the development of defense technology R&D and innovative startup companies.
